Finding light for Phagnalon sordidum in your home
a window
Phagnalon sordidum may have difficulty thriving, and will drop leaves 🍃, without ample sunlight.
Place it less than 3 feet from a south-facing window to maximize the potential for growth.

How to fertilize Phagnalon sordidum
Most potting soils come with ample nutrients which plants use to produce new growth.
By the time your plant has depleted the nutrients in its soil it’s likely grown enough to need a larger pot anyway.
To replenish this plant's nutrients, repot your Phagnalon sordidum after it doubles in size or once a year—whichever comes first.
